Gemini Clip Privacy Policy
Last updated: July 21, 2026
Gemini Clip is designed to perform its work locally in your browser. This page explains what the extension accesses and why.
Data collection
Gemini Clip does not collect, sell, share, or transmit personal data to the developer, advertising networks, or analytics services. The developer does not receive your Gemini conversations, selected content, images, settings, or usage history.
Selected text and images
Gemini Clip reads text and images only after you explicitly start selection and choose content on gemini.google.com. The selected content is processed locally so it can be placed into the Gemini draft you choose. The extension does not send messages automatically.
For an image you select, Gemini Clip may request the original image bytes from a Gemini or Google-hosted image resource. This happens only to complete your requested import. The extension does not upload the image to a developer-operated server.
Local and temporary storage
The extension stores preferences such as language, floating-button visibility, and custom shortcuts in Chrome extension storage. It may also keep the last selection and a pending import payload locally so an import can survive Gemini’s chat navigation and so you can repeat the last selection.
Selected original images can be larger than Chrome’s standard extension-storage quota. Gemini Clip therefore requests unlimitedStorage to avoid silently truncating or losing user-selected images. This permission does not give the developer access to your files or browser data.
You can remove imported draft content with Gemini Clip’s Clear button. You can remove stored extension data by clearing the extension’s data or uninstalling the extension. Stale pending payloads expire automatically.

Remote code and tracking
Gemini Clip does not execute remote code. It contains no advertising, analytics, telemetry, or cross-site tracking.
Optional donations
Gemini Clip is free. Optional support buttons open PayPal’s external website. Donations are voluntary, unlock no feature, and are handled by PayPal. Gemini Clip does not collect or process payment information.
